The Role of Turbine Blades
Turbine blades are one of the most critical LM6000 parts because they are exposed to extremely high temperatures and pressure during operation. Blades that are damaged, worn, or not properly manufactured can reduce the turbine’s efficiency and increase the risk of mechanical failure. Regular inspection and replacement of turbine blades help maintain optimal airflow, prevent overheating, and reduce the likelihood of unexpected downtime. By using durable LM6000 parts for blades, operators can significantly extend the service life of their turbines.
Combustion Components and Efficiency
The combustion section of a gas turbine is responsible for burning fuel efficiently to generate energy. LM6000 parts such as combustion liners, fuel nozzles, and transition pieces play a key role in ensuring that fuel is burned evenly and at the right temperature. Worn or damaged combustion components can lead to hot spots, increased emissions, and reduced efficiency. Maintaining high-quality LM6000 parts in the combustion section helps the turbine run smoothly, lowers maintenance costs, and prolongs overall operational life.
Seals and Protective Components
Seals and other protective LM6000 parts are essential for preventing leaks and protecting sensitive components from heat and pressure. If seals fail, the turbine may experience reduced performance, overheating, or even catastrophic failure. By regularly replacing seals and using genuine LM6000 parts, operators can maintain proper pressure levels, improve reliability, and reduce the risk of costly repairs. These small components may seem minor, but they are crucial for preserving the long-term health of the turbine.
Control System Components
Modern gas turbines rely heavily on sophisticated control systems to optimize performance. LM6000 parts in control systems, such as sensors, actuators, and controllers, help monitor temperature, speed, and pressure. Malfunctioning control parts can lead to inefficient operation, reduced power output, and increased wear on mechanical components. Ensuring that control system LM6000 parts are up-to-date and functioning correctly helps the turbine respond to operational demands effectively and prevents unnecessary strain on critical components.
